Danang Catheral

The Danang Cathedral is one of the most popular tourist spots with its distinctive pink architecture in Danang. It is known by the locals as the rooster Church because of the rooster on its weather vane. Another Catholic Church down the road sports a fish. It is close to the fish market so its parishners are fishermen.

Danang Cathedral is one of those grand old Churches. It was built for the French residents in 1923 and remains in great condition today. Danang Cathedral can accommodate more than 4,000 members of the Catholic community in the area .Like all Catholic Church compounds you are not just offered a Church but a compound for meditation, instruction and houses for the staff.

The architecture of the cathedral is marvellous with several medieval–stained glass windows of various saints. Masses are held from Monday to Saturday at 5 a.m. and 5 p.m., and on Sunday at 5:00 a.m., 6:30 a.m. and 4:30 p.m.

Almost all of these Churches have a school nearby that used to be a Catholic School. They are all confiscated by the government and are now public schools.
